Jayson Tatum explodes with 51 points, Boston Celtics sink 76ers to enter Eastern finals
Entering the first half, the two teams showed a fairly even position. PJ Tucker suddenly got himself 3 phases 3 points in the first half to help the visitors take the lead 29-23.
The second half is the stage of the two No. 1 stars of the two teams. Jayson Tatum and Joel Embiid compete to shine for their team. Tatum personally scored 20 points and Joel Embiid scored 13 points before entering the halftime break. The Boston Celtics temporarily led 55-52 after the second half ended.

After the first half of the tense match, it seemed that the two teams would struggle until the end of Game 7. But I don't understand what coach Joe Mazzulla said to the students during the break, but the Boston Celtics suddenly exploded.
The home team set up a series of 28-6 points to continuously force the Philadelphia 76ers to call a timeout. The biggest credit in this series of points belongs to Jayson Tatum, who not only has very hot hands at the throws, but also launched many difficult to succeed in the basket.
There were no surprises in the fourth quarter when Joel Embiid and James Harden were almost locked, leading the Boston Celtics to a convincing 112-88 victory in Game 7.

This result helped Jayson Tatum and his teammates complete a spectacular comeback in the Eastern semi-finals. They won 3 consecutive matches to eliminate the Philadelphia 76ers with a total score of 4-3, winning a ticket to the regional final against the Miami Heat.
Close brother Jaylen Brown was right behind with 25 points and 6 rebounds. It is impossible to ignore Al Horford, who played extremely well in defense to stop new MVP Joel Embiid.
On the Philadelphia 76ers side, Tobias Harris leads with 19 points. Joel Embiid did not leave much of an impression with 15 points and 8 rebounds. James Harden is also "missing" with only 3-11 FG, scoring 9 points and 7 assists.

After this game, the Boston Celtics will advance to the Eastern Finals series against the Miami Heat. Game 1 of this series will start at 7:30 am on Thursday, May 18.
